Shares of Sol-Gel Technologies Ltd. (NASDAQ:SLGL – Get Free Report) traded up 5.2% during trading on Wednesday . The stock traded as high as $0.60 and last traded at $0.59. 11,111 shares traded hands during trading, a decline of 96% from the average session volume of 252,685 shares. The stock had previously closed at $0.56.
Sol-Gel Technologies Stock Up 5.2 %
The company’s 50-day moving average is $0.68 and its 200 day moving average is $0.69. The company has a market cap of $16.38 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-1.73 and a beta of 1.29.

Sol-Gel Technologies Company Profile
Sol-Gel Technologies Ltd., together with its subsidiary Sol-Gel Technologies Inc, develops topical dermatological drugs for patients with severe skin conditions in Israel. The company offers Twyneo, a once-daily, non-antibiotic topical cream for the treatment of acne vulgaris; and Epsolay, a once-daily topical cream for the treatment of papulopustular (subtype II) rosacea.
